本文分类:news发布日期:2025/2/24 0:10:25
相关文章
第七章 JVM对高效并发的支持
一. Java内存模型与内存间的交互操作
1. Java内存模型
1.1 概念 1.2 示意图 1.3 规则 2. 内存交互
2.1 操作名词 2.2 操作流程 2.3 操作的规则 二. volatile(❤❤❤)
1. 多线程可见性 2. volatile 2.1 不安全演示
package src.com.yh.jvm.parallel;/*** 演示volatile多线程…
建站知识
2025/2/23 13:08:05
牛客网最新 Java 面试 1210 道题附答案汇总
很多 Java 工程师的技术不错,但是一面试就头疼,10 次面试 9 次都是被刷,过的那次还是去了家不知名的小公司。
问题就在于:面试有技巧,而你不会把自己的能力表达给面试官。 应届生:你该如何准备简历&#x…
建站知识
2025/2/19 23:17:02
OpenCV图像处理方法:腐蚀操作
腐蚀操作
前提
图像数据为二值的(黑/白)
作用 去掉图片中字上的毛刺
显示图片
读取一个图像文件,并在一个窗口中显示它。用户可以查看这个图像,直到按下任意键,然后程序会关闭显示图像的窗口
# cv2是OpenCV库的P…
建站知识
2025/2/11 6:36:53
DNS域名解析服务器
一.DNS简介 DNS(Domain Name System)是互联网上的一项服务,它作为将域名和IP地址相互映射的一个分布式 数据库,能够使人更方便的访问互联网。 DNS系统使用的是网络的查询,那么自然需要有监听的port。DNS使用的是53端口…
建站知识
2025/2/13 1:29:00
2807. 在链表中插入最大公约数 辗转相除和BigDecimal自带求公约数实现
2807. 在链表中插入最大公约数 给你一个链表的头 head ,每个结点包含一个整数值。 在相邻结点之间,请你插入一个新的结点,结点值为这两个相邻结点值的 最大公约数 。 请你返回插入之后的链表。 两个数的 最大公约数 是可以被两个数字整除的最…
建站知识
2025/2/11 16:28:49
Git - 如何删除 push 过一次的文件链路追踪?
(以 target 文件夹为例)如果你已经在 .gitignore 中添加了 target/ 目录,但 target 文件夹仍然出现在 Git 的变更列表中,可能是因为它之前已经被添加到 Git 仓库中。即使你更新了 .gitignore,Git 仍然会跟踪这些文件。…
建站知识
2025/2/17 13:47:43
代码随想录算法训练营第十一天(补) 栈与队列| 后序表达式、滑动窗口、高频元素、链表总结
目录 一、150. 逆波兰表达式求值
二、239. 滑动窗口最大值
三、347.前 K 个高频元素
四、总结 一、150. 逆波兰表达式求值
力扣题目链接(opens new window)
根据 逆波兰表示法,求表达式的值。
有效的运算符包括 , - , * , / 。每个运算对象可以是整数&#x…
建站知识
2025/2/17 5:28:45
代码质量与项目进度的博弈
在软件开发的过程中,代码质量和项目进度常常处于矛盾之中。当面对紧迫的截止日期时,是否应该牺牲代码质量来满足时间要求?牺牲代码质量可能会导致技术债务累积、影响产品稳定性、增加后期维护成本,因此,不应以牺牲质量…
建站知识
2025/2/23 8:42:57